Montra Electric Partners Perpetuity Capital to Expand EV Financing Access

Volume 1 Issue 16 Header Banner

Montra Electric has partnered with Perpetuity Capital to make financing more accessible for customers purchasing its electric passenger and cargo three-wheelers in India. The companies have sign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) aimed at reducing financial barriers to EV adoption.

Flexible Finance for Electric Three-Wheelers

Under the partnership, Perpetuity Capital will offer financing solutions for Montra Electric’s three-wheeler portfolio. The options are designed to support different ownership and business requirements while simplifying the vehicle purchase process.

The financing programme will cater to:

  • Individual drivers and owner-operators
  • Entrepreneurs and small businesses
  • Fleet operators
  • Customers purchasing passenger and cargo EVs

Karamveer Singh Dhillon, Co-founder and CEO of Perpetuity Capital, said accessible and flexible credit is important for accelerating EV adoption, particularly among entrepreneurs and commercial customers who depend on these vehicles for their livelihoods.

Lowering Barriers to EV Adoption

Electric three-wheelers are increasingly being adopted for passenger mobility, goods transportation and last-mile delivery. However, financing remains an important factor influencing purchase decisions, particularly for individual operators and small businesses.

By combining Montra Electric’s vehicle portfolio with Perpetuity Capital’s financing solutions, the partnership aims to make electric mobility more financially viable for a wider customer base.

Supporting India’s Commercial EV Growth

The collaboration also strengthens access to financing for customers transitioning from conventional vehicles to electric alternatives. With tailored credit solutions, Montra Electric and Perpetuity Capital aim to support wider adoption of electric three-wheelers across India’s commercial mobility ecosystem.
